Krause, Karen Lee was born on October 5, 1940 in Toledo. Daughter of Richard F. and Roberta M. (Wunder) Krause.
Diploma, Maumee Valley Hospital School Nursi, Toledo, 1962. Bachelor of Science, University Toledo, 1976. Master in Public Health, University Michigan, 1982.
Director social services North Starr Borough C.A.P., Fairbanks, Alaska, 1968-1969. Staff nurse dialysis Medical College Ohio, Toledo, 1970-1971. Public health nurse Lucas County Health Department, 1971-1972.
Field nurse consultant Ohio Department Health, Maternal and Child Health Bureau, Columbus, 1971-1976. Director nursing Lucas County Health Department, Toledo, 1976-1993, Community Health Consultant, Toledo, since 1993. Executive director Mildred Bayer Clinic for the Homeless, since 1998.
OPHA representative Ohio Department Health, Maternal and Child Health Block Grant Advisory Group, Columbus, 1982-1989. Corporation secretary, board directors Northwest Ohio Health Planning Inc., Cordelia Martin Health Center, Toledo, 1986-1989. President Toledo Area Acquired Immune Deficiency Syndrome Task Force, Inc., 1986-1989.
Legislation chairman Toledo Coalition for Adolescent Pregnancy Prevention, Toledo, 1986, Coalition for Revision of the Ohio Nurse Practice Act, Columbus, 1987. Appointee Governor's Task Force on Teenage Pregnancy, Columbus, 1986. Member commission on nursing Ohio General Assembly, 1990-1991.
Legislation action chair Northwest Ohio Coalition for National Health Care, 1990-1997. Executive chair New World Order/Universal Health Care Action Network, since 1997. Steering committee Universal Health Care for Ohio (UHIO), since 1990, also trustee.
Vice chair Ohio Public Health Services Study Committee, 1992-1993. Member council and steering committee Lucas County Families and Children First, 1993. Member Congresswoman Marcy Kaptur's Health Advisory Group, 1994.
Endorsed candidate Ohio House of Representatives, 1996. Member League of Women Voters, American Association of University Women, American Nurses Association, Ohio Nurses Association (Excellence in Nursing award 1987), American Public Health Association, Ohio Public Health Association (governor's council 1983-1985, 97—, co-chair public policy since 1997, Juris Doctor Porterfield award 1993), National League for Nursing, American Society Law and Medicine, Ohio League for Nursing, Sigma Theta Tau.
